4. Toys
Chew Toys
Border Collies are high-energy dogs, so they need plenty of toys to keep them entertained. We recommend getting a few different kinds of toys, including chew toys, fetch toys, and puzzle toys. They need to be able to burn off all that energy somehow, and a variety of toys will keep your Collie from getting bored with just one!

6. Crate
You’ll need a crate for your Border Collie. Crates are great for potty training and keeping your dog safe when you can’t supervise them. We recommend getting a crate that’s made of durable material and is the right size for your dog. Make sure you choose a crate that is large enough to still accommodate your Collie as it grows as well.

12. Flea and Tick Prevention
If you live in an area with fleas and ticks, you’ll need to get some prevention for your Border Collie. We recommend getting a monthly topical treatment that’s specifically designed for dogs. This is a supply that you’ll have to make sure to stay on top of replacing. Your vet can also recommend and prescribe flea and tick treatments for your dog.

15. Paw Balm
If you live in a cold climate, you’ll need to get some paw balm for your Border Collie. Paw balm is great for keeping your dog’s paws moisturized and protected from the cold. If you live in a hot climate, paw balm can also help protect your dog’s paw pads from getting scorched on the hot sidewalk.

18. Winter Coat
If you live in a really cold climate, you may need to get a winter coat for your Border Collie. Winter coats are great for keeping your dog warm and protected from the cold. Keep in mind that Border Collies have long coats already, so winter coats aren’t necessary unless your dog is going to be spending a lot of time outside.
